Former Federal Reserve Chair Paul Volcker, who helped shape American economic policy for decades, died this morning. Today, we look over his impact on the economy, and recall the time he raised interest rates to 21.5%. Plus: A new innovation that could make recycling more efficient, how to make kids’ entertainment more diverse, and the “smoker’s track” at work.
